Healthcare professionals today face mounting pressure to document accurately, communicate clearly, and stay current with medical research, all while delivering quality patient care. This free course on AI for healthcare professionals walks you through the practical applications of AI across clinical work, hospital administration, and patient engagement. Starting from the fundamentals, you will explore how AI tools fit into modern medical settings before moving into the clinical applications that matter most: reducing the time spent on documentation and notes, supporting diagnostic reasoning, and assisting with treatment planning and decision support.
The course also covers the operational side of healthcare that often goes unaddressed in clinical training. Modules on AI for scheduling, medical coding and billing, and patient communication show how administrative staff, nurses, and doctors alike can reclaim time by working alongside AI tools rather than against a growing paperwork burden. A dedicated module on patient monitoring and telehealth, as well as AI for medical literature review, rounds out the coverage for those working in research or remote care settings.
Designed for beginners with no coding background required, the course closes with a close look at the ethical considerations, HIPAA compliance, and data privacy responsibilities that every healthcare professional must understand before deploying AI in a clinical environment.
